The Life of Robert Greene. Robert Greene was born in Norwich in about 1560 to parents of the tradesmen’s class. Educated at Cambridge, Greene travelled extensively on the continent, claiming to have lived a debauched and dissolute lifestyle throughout his youth. In fact, Greene’s life of degeneracy and waste seems to have been the primary ... In 1592, the English writer and member of the literary establishment Robert Greene wrote a pamphlet titled Groats-worth of Witte. In that he ventured the opinion that a new writer on the scene was: An upstart crow, beautified with our feathers, that supposes he is as well able to bumbast out a blanke verse as the best of you.

Robert Greene of Gillingham was born circa 1480 to John Greene (c1450-) . Robert was a son of "John Greene the Fugitive". He bought an estate called Bowridge Hill or Porridge Hill at Gillingham in Dorset and was described in a 1543 subsidy roll as "an elderly man with grandchildren".
